Homiel: Belsat TV contributor facing hefty fine over Facebook video

The Homiel police sent a protocol to freelance journalist Kastus Zhukouski. He is accused of illegal production and distribution of media products.

In mid March, the local police raided the house of Homiel-based activist Barys Anikeyeu over allegedly ‘insulting the president’. Two policemen entered his house without giving any reasons or showing a search warrant, later seven officers joined them. They locked Anikeyeu and his family in the house and let no one in. Journalist Kastus Zhukouski arrived at the scene and started filming.

Now the authorities are charging him with violation of the law due his web streaming on his own Facebook account. In accordance with Article 22.9 of the Administrative Code, a fine of up to BYN 1,225 may be imposed on the freelancer.
